EIGHT CIVILIANS KILLED IN DRC

EIGHT civilians have been killed and two women kidnapped in the north of DRC, authorities have announced in the region controlled by the Rwandan-backed rebel Congolese Rally for Democracy (RCD). It said the deaths took place between May 7-11. “One person was killed in an attack on a fishing ground in Zirwa, next to Lake Edward, four people were killed in Kanyabushureriri and three others were killed on Munyaga road, in Rutshuru territory, the Nord-Kivu region authorities announced on Saturday. Two women were also kidnapped in Rumangabo, according to the same source, which blames the violence on Rwandan rebels. -AFP
